Saudi Arabia - Import of Crude Coconut (Copra) Oil

Since 2014, Saudi Arabia Import of Crude Coconut (Copra) Oil decreased by 0.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 48 among other countries in Import of Crude Coconut (Copra) Oil at $705,759.54. Saudi Arabia is overtaken by Kenya, which was ranked number 47 with $791,458.19 and is followed by Turkey with $644,956. Netherlands topped the ranking with $477,756,138.86 in 2019, that is an increase of 9.3% compared to 2018. United States, Germany and Malaysia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Rwanda witnessed the best average annual growth at +607% per year, while Myanmar recorded the worst performance at -86.9% per year.
